Dating can be a bit like navigating a winding road with unexpected twists and turns, and it can be especially interesting if you're bisexual. Having romantic relationships with both men and women certainly spices things up, bringing an array that spans joy, challenges, and everything in between. Many bisexual folks have shared their experiences, which highlight some intriguing and sometimes subtle differences when dating across genders.>
One thing that stands out in bisexual dating dynamics? Communication styles. A lotta bisexual people notice that women tend towards being more open and expressive with their feelings. This can lead us down a path where conversations get deep and emotional bonds strengthen. On a different note, men often lean towards a more direct style, focusing on solving problems rather than discussing feelings. Of course, these aren't hard and fast rules, but they're observations that frequently come up.>
For bisexuals, switching between partners across genders can be quite refreshing due, in part, due these communication differences. It turns out that dealing with varied styles can actually boost one's interpersonal skills and emotional smarts.>
Societal norms play a huge role in shaping relationships, and this dramatically shifts between heterosexual and same-gender dynamics. Sometimes, bisexual folks feel more accepted when they're with a male partner, while relationships with women might attract more scrutiny or stereotypes. This can create tricky situations, pushing people either towards fitting in or standing up and explaining why their relationships are valid and real.>
Even with these hurdles, there's a lotta power in embracing diverse dating experiences. Many bisexual people feel empowered when they push against societal pressures and challenge those pesky stereotypes.>
Another area where contrasts might emerge? Physical affection. Some bisexual people mention that women are generally more touchy-feely, creating a warm, cozy vibe that's full on nurturing. On other hand, guys might show love by doing fun things together or through encouraging words.>
Though these aren't universal truths, they offer some pretty cool insights on how gender shapes intimacy and affection in a relationship.>
Emotional labor can be another field where we see varied patterns. Many bisexual individuals notice women are more likely involved in emotional labor, like planning dates or caring about a partner's feelings. This can create a nurturing environment, but it might also lead some imbalance if one person always shouldering emotional loads.>
When it comes relationships with men, some bisexual folks find emotional work either more balanced or find themselves doing more heavy lifting emotionally. Figuring out how navigate these dynamics can be key keeping relationships healthy.>
The dating adventures bisexuals embark on reveal an intricate tapestry woven with human interactions and gender dynamics. While patterns in communication, societal pressure, affection, and emotional labor often crop up, they vary wildly depending on personal quirks and relationship dynamics.>
At its core, successful relationships, regardless gender, hinge on understanding, open dialogues, and mutual respect. By sharing these diverse experiences, bisexual people not only enrich their own romantic lives but also broaden our collective understanding love that comes in many beautiful shapes and forms.>
